In the abdomen of the female Cockroach eight terga (1–7; 10) are externally visible. Two more (8, 9) are readily displayed by extending the abdomen; they are ordinarily concealed beneath the seventh tergum. The tenth tergum is notched in the middle of its posterior margin. A pair of triangular “podical plates,” which lie on either side of the anus, and towards the dorsal surface, have been provisionally regarded by Prof. Huxley as the terga of an eleventh segment. Seven abdominal sterna (1–7) are externally visible. The first is quite rudimentary, and consists of a transversely oval plate; the second is irregular and imperfectly chitinised in front; the seventh is large, and its hinder part, which is boat-shaped, is divided into lateral halves, for facilitating the discharge of the large egg-capsule.

In the male Cockroach ten abdominal terga are visible without dissection (fig. [33], p. 70), though the eighth and ninth are greatly overlapped by the seventh. The tenth tergum is hardly notched. Nine abdominal sterna are readily made out, the first being rudimentary, as in the female. The eighth is narrower than the seventh, the ninth still narrower, and largely concealed by the eighth; its covered anterior part is thin and transparent, the exposed part denser. This forms the extreme end of the body, except that the small sub-anal styles project beyond it. The podical plates resemble those of the female.
Pleural elements are developed in the form of narrow stigmatic plates, with the free edge directed backwards. These lie between the terga and sterna, and defend the spiracle.[80]
The modifications of the hindmost abdominal segments will be more fully considered in connection with the reproductive organs.
The high number of abdominal segments found in the Cockroach (ten or eleven) is characteristic of the lower orders of Insecta. It is never exceeded; though in the more specialised orders, such as Lepidoptera and Diptera, it may be reduced to nine, eight, or even seven. The sessile abdomen of the Cockroach is primitive with respect to the pedunculate abdomen found in such insects as Hymenoptera, where the constricted and flexible waist stands in obvious relation to the operations of stinging and boring, or to peculiar modes of oviposition. The first abdominal segment, which is especially liable to dislocation and alteration in Insects, occupies its theoretical position in the Cockroach, though both tergum and sternum are reduced in size. The sternum is often altogether wanting, while the tergum may unite with the metathorax.
